Rifles soldier killed in Afghanistan


A SOLDIER from A Company, 3rd Battalion The Rifles, died today in an explosion in Sangin, Helmand Province, the Ministry of Defence said. Next of kin have been informed.

Spokesman for Task Force Helmand, Lieutenant Colonel David Wakefield, said the soldier was on foot patrol crossing a bridge when he was hit by an improvised explosive device (IED).

He said: "His bravery and selfless commitment to his comrades and to this fight will not be forgotten."
